Traditionally, stock exchanges and many financial markets operate only during specific business hours on weekdays. Once markets close on Friday, investors often need to wait until Monday to react to major developments. However, today's interconnected global economy generates news and events around the clock. Economic reports, geopolitical developments, technological breakthroughs, and corporate announcements can occur at any time.

Cryptocurrency markets helped popularize the concept of continuous trading. Assets such as **$BTC**, **$ETH**, and **$GT** trade 24 hours a day, seven days a week, allowing participants to respond immediately to changing market conditions. This constant availability has reshaped expectations among many investors, who now value flexibility and real-time market access.
